Why Temporary Site Alarm Systems



Building sites, empty buildings, and temporary workplaces create specific risks.
Without fixed infrastructure, fire alarms and protection solutions must be portable, durable, and easy to deploy.
This is where solutions like GoLink connectivity, Howler HO alarms, and site alarm systems become essential.



Portable systems are designed to operate in challenging environments where dust, activity, and changing layouts are common.
A reliable system not only warns workers to fire hazards but also discourages intrusion and damage.



Key Features of GoLink Connectivity



Howler GoLink systems are cable-free and interconnected, allowing multiple alarms to connect without complex wiring.
This makes them ideal for changing environments.



  • Wireless connectivity lowers setup effort

  • Scalable systems allow additional units as the site develops

  • Centralised warnings ensure all alarms trigger together

  • Battery-powered operation work without mains supply



As layouts change, units can be repositioned easily, ensuring ongoing coverage.



The Role of Howler HO Alarms



Howler HO alarms are engineered with powerful audio output to cut through noisy conditions.
Busy construction sites often involve equipment, which can drown out standard alarms.



A strong audible signal ensures warnings are clearly heard, allowing workers to act promptly.
These alarms are commonly used in:



  • Construction zones

  • Refurbishment works

  • Open-plan environments

Dedicated Fire Detection Solutions



Howler site fire alarms are designed to detect fire risks quickly in temporary or partially fixed environments.
They are engineered to handle harsh conditions, vibration, and environmental exposure.



Key setup points include:



  • Position alarms in critical areas such as storage locations and electrical setups

  • Provide complete protection across all areas

  • Perform regular checks to confirm correct operation

  • Use interconnected systems for enhanced communication

Installation Tips for Improved Results



  • Assess the site layout and identify key zones

  • Plan for changes over time

  • Carry out routine checks to maintain reliability

  • Check power sources to avoid failures

  • Ensure staff understanding on how the system functions



Clear procedures help support quick action and reduce confusion.
